Stolen Face Monk Overview: Tactics and Persona
The Kenku Monk presents a truly unique experience for players, demanding a blend of careful combat thinking and inspired roleplaying. Essentially, you’re playing a character who can’t originate anything – all actions and phrases must be mimicked from others, leading to memorable and potentially complex scenarios. Concerning combat, focus on swiftness and exploiting your environment; the Kenku’s Flight can be utilized for benefit and to circumvent danger. Consider abilities like Step of the Wind for quick movement and Flurry of Blows for sustained damage. From a character perspective, lean into the humor of your situation, thoughtfully observing and reproducing the copyright of those around you.

Revealing the Feathered Man's Martial Adept Potential
The Kenku Monk can often feel constricted by their absence to cast spells and their reliance on mimicry. Despite this, with careful planning and a clever build, this unique class combination can truly excel. Focusing on mobility and trickery is key; leveraging the Kenku’s check here inherent agility to confuse enemies while inflicting damage is far more beneficial than attempting a direct damage build. Consider these paths to fully achieve their potential:
- Mastery of movement: Prioritize feats like Mobile and methods that enhance your ability to dodge attacks and place yourself strategically.
- Embrace the deceiver: Utilize your ability to mimic enemy behaviors and exploit their vulnerabilities.
- Integrate with items that enhance stealth and illusion. A well-chosen charm or tool can dramatically boost your impact.
Ultimately, the productive Kenku Monk isn’t about brute force; it’s about wit and outmaneuvering your foes. With a little creativity, you can turn this ostensibly disadvantage into a significant strength.
